Basketball Recap: Northmor Golden Knights vs. Centerburg Trojans
Northmor had already won two in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 16.5 points) and they went ahead and made it three on Saturday. They managed a 56-52 victory over the Centerburg Trojans. The Golden Knights have seen this before: they got the W the last time they saw the Trojans, too.
Aj Bower was a one-man wrecking crew for Northmor as he went 6 of 12 on his way to 20 points. The team also got some help courtesy of Bodden Landin, who posted seven points and seven rebounds.

Northmor pushed their record up to 12-4 with the win, which was their sixth straight at home.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 62.3 points per game. As for Centerburg,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 10-7.
Northmor will host Loudonville at 7:15 p.m. on Tuesday. Northmor has been dominant on offense recently, having racked up an incredible 187 points over their last three matches. As for Centerburg, they will square off against Fredericktown at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
